Michal Kluknavský
About
Michal Kluknavský has authored 16 papers that have received a total of 376 indexed citations.
This includes 8 papers in Physiology, 8 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ine and 4 papers in Nutrition and Dietetics. The topics of these papers are Renin-Angiotensin System Studies (4 papers), Stress Responses and Cortisol (4 papers) and Biochemical effects in animals (4 papers). Michal Kluknavský is often cited by papers focused on Renin-Angiotensin System Studies (4 papers), Stress Responses and Cortisol (4 papers) and Biochemical effects in animals (4 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Slovakia and Czechia. Michal Kluknavský's co-authors include Iveta Bernátová, Peter Bališ, Angelika Púzserová, Andrea Berenyiová and Soňa Čačányiová and has published in prestigious journals such as International Journal of Molecular Sciences, BioMed Research International and Journal of Hypertension.
